About the team
The People Operations team plays a critical role in ensuring our culture scales with our growth. We design and manage core people processes, data systems, and programs that support the employee lifecycle globally, partnering closely with People Strategy, Finance, Legal, and IT. Our focus is on creating efficient, secure, and people-driven solutions that elevate the employee experience and enable business success.
About the role
Rapid7 is seeking a Director, People Operations to lead and develop a talented team while driving scalable, efficient, and compliant people processes that support our distinctive culture. Reporting to the SVP, Strategic People Operations, this role will focus on operational excellence, process improvement, and seamless data ,programs, and analytics delivery across the employee lifecycle. You'll collaborate across the broader People Strategy organization to ensure our programs and systems enable a world-class employee experience and align with business needs globally.
In this role, you will:
  • Manage and optimize global people operations processes, including onboarding, offboarding, and Workday administration.
  • Ensure secure, compliant, and accurate employee data management while driving process improvement and automation.
  • Partner with People Strategy teams (People Strategists, Learning & Development, Total Rewards, Talent Acquisition) to deliver consistent operational support and reporting.
  • Develop and maintain people metrics and reporting, leveraging Workday dashboards and analytics tools to inform decision-making.
  • Support vendor management, including PEO relationships and coordination of global site setup and closure activities.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ional partners in Legal, Finance, and IT to ensure compliance and alignment with business objectives.
  • Contribute to workforce planning, process documentation, and operational readiness for growth initiatives and organizational change.
  • Lead and develop a high-performing global team, fostering acc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ement.

The skills and qualities you'll bring include:
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ience.
  • 7+ years of experience in People Operations and/or Total Rewards (Compensation, Benefits, HRIS), ideally within the high-tech industry.
  • Proven experience improving processes and systems with a focus on efficiency and employee experience.
  • Strong collaboration skills with the ability to partner effectively across global People Strategy teams.
  • Experience managing Workday data, reporting, and analytics; familiarity with dashboards and metrics is a plus.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ead and develop a team in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.
  • High attention to detail, operational rigor, and ability to manage multiple priorities.

Rapid7, Inc. is committed to fair and equitable compensation practices. A candidate's salary is determined by various factors including, but not limited to, relevant work experience, skills, and certifications. We evaluate compensation decisions on a case-by-case basis, and it is not typical for an individual to be hired at the very top of the salary range.
The salary range for this role in the US is:
$156,700.00 - 211,900.00 USD Annual
Salary ranges may vary based on geographical location. This range does not include variable/incentive compensation, equity and benefits (where applicable/eligible).

What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ene

Austin has a diverse and thriving tech ecosystem thanks to home-grown companies like Dell and major campuses for IBM, AMD and Apple. The state’s flagship university, the University of Texas at Austin, is known for its engineering school, and the city is known for its annual South by Southwest tech and media conference. Austin’s tech scene spans many verticals, but it’s particularly known for hardware, including semiconductors, as well as AI, biotechnology and cloud computing. And its food and music scene, low taxes and favorable climate has made the city a destination for tech workers from across the country.

Key Facts About Austin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
